My approach to therapy

With 18+ years experience in social work and ministry, I am adept at working with a diverse population and trained in a variety of somatic-based and trauma-informed approaches. My practice is shaped by my background in mindfulness, spiritual direction, death and dying, competitive athletics, animal-assisted therapy, international work, and love of the outdoors.
